Mermaid Mirror by HouseofChabrier

24" X 48" Etched Mirror from the back for the Lighthouse Restaurant in St. Petersburgh Florida done about 30 Years ago, and if this place is still around and the mirror is still up send me a better picture. This is the only one I have of this work, and it's not very good.

  • Copy Link:
  • SN Code:
  • Short URL:
  • Press Enter to submit and Shift+Enter to add a line
  • JurgenDoe


    I hope the restaurant is still there .. did you try to find the address and phone # .. maybe you can call them :)

    Sep 10th, 2011 Reply Subscriber